Benefits of AP Courses
AP courses are college-level courses taught in high school. Students may earn college credit by taking the corresponding AP exam and obtaining a credit-qualifying score (qualifying scores may differ by college/university). Students can benefit from taking an AP course in the following ways:
- Earn college credit (AP Credit Policy Database)
- Build college skills
- Stand out in the college admission process
